CEIBA Foundation Seeds of Sustainability Grants 2026 (Up to $5,000 Grant Funding)

    Applications are open for CEIBA Foundation Seeds of Sustainability Grants 2026. The Seeds of Sustainability Fund is intended to stimulate or catalyze projects that address biodiversity loss, climate change, and environmental inequality.

    Non-profit organizations, community organizations or associations, small businesses, and individuals from developing countries in the tropics are eligible to apply.

    They support the following kinds of applicants and projects:

    • small to medium-sized organizations
    • community-led programs, or occasionally projects led by a single person
    • conservation that emphasizes equitable community involvement
    • projects that connect with UN Sustainable Development Goals and CBD Biodiversity Targets
    • bottom-up over top-down approaches
    • projects in the tropics, in areas of high and/or threatened biodiversity
    • projects where a small amount of funding can make a big difference
    • projects with a minimum duration of 4 months and a maximum of 2 years

    Conservation Priorities

    Ceiba has supported the protection of threatened tropical species and habitats for years through a combination of conservation programs, research, and educational outreach. We emphasize connecting people with nature, and ensuring that conservation projects genuinely listen to, are led by, and actively benefit stakeholders.

    Proposals for *first-time applicants* of Seeds of Sustainability funding should link to one of the following focus areas:

    • Protection, conservation, and anti-poaching of over-exploited species (terrestrial or marine):
      • Species population monitoring and recovery plans; protection of nesting, breeding, or spawning sites; alternative livelihood programs to reduce hunting or fishing pressure; enforcement support and reporting systems; bycatch reduction strategies
    • Habitat protection and restoration focused on corridors and habitat connectivity (terrestrial or marine):
      • Reserve establishment and management, assisted regeneration, habitat restoration, connectivity assessments, etc

    Seeds of Sustainability Grants Funding Details

    The level of funding applicants may request depends on their level of partnership.

    • First-time applicants:  Anyone applying for the first time to for a Seeds of Sustainability grant may request up to $5,000 maximum.
    • Conservation Partners:  First-time grant recipients who demonstrate successful completion of their project, may be invited to join our Conservation Partner network and be eligible to apply for $10,000 (or more) annually.  Continuation of funding depends highly on the ability to demonstrate tangible conservation outcomes that align with our Conservation Priorities after each funding cycle.

    Eligibility Criteria

    Only organizations that meet the following eligibility criteria may apply for a Seeds of Sustainability grant:

    • Small non-profit organizations, indigenous community groups, schools or small universities, individuals, and other types of local organizations/associations, except those engaged primarily in religious or political activities, are eligible to apply.
    • Projects must be carried out in a country within the tropics, and align with at least one of Ceiba’s Conservation Priorities.
    • Non-profits must be able to provide documentation of their non-profit status. Schools and other types of organization/associations must provide a document that shows the constitution or establishment of this entity. Other types of applicants including individuals must be able to provide a letter of support from a community leader, government entity, supervisor, or other person not directly involved in the project.
    • Individual applicants must demonstrate that they have already committed some resources (funds, labor, materials) to initiate their project.
    • Only small organizations are eligible (with total annual budgets <$500,000).

    How To Apply for Seeds of Sustainability Grants

    Applicants must first complete the Eligibility Check using the button above. If you meet the criteria, you will then be directed to the application link

    To apply:

    1. Complete the Eligibility Check
    2. Complete the online application form.  Applications must be in either English or Spanish. You may start your form and return to it later. To help you prepare your application before entering text into the online form, you may download the  questions and content guidelines in PDF format.
    3. Prepare your budget using the form provided and upload it with your application.
    4. Upload supporting documents (see eligibility requirements above).

    Application Deadline: May 15, 2026
